Airbus Loop space station, illustration

Illustration of the Airbus Loop space station, with a connected Spartan Space inflatable module and a docked Orion European Service Module. Airbus has proposed a multi-purpose orbital module called the Airbus Loop space station. This space platform is designed to be flown into orbit as a ready-to-use module. The LOOP is 8 metres in size and is designed to fit into the upcoming generation of superheavy launchers, such as SpaceX's Starship. It can thus be deployed with a single launch and become habitable immediately after reaching orbit. LOOP features a habitation deck, a science deck and a centrifuge deck producing artificial gravity, where inhabitants could receive temporary relief from zero-gravity conditions.
